Holmwood Estate.
A" Ceylon Observer" cable states that the directors, of the Golconda Malay Rubber Company have passed a resolution that the Ilolmwood estate should be taken over on January 1 next. The nationated output for 1013 is 72,675 lbs., and for 1914 145,000 Tbs. The present acreage is 1,137 ores. The output for 1910 was 178,315 lbs., and a dividend of 55 per cent. was declared.
Copra Prices.
Copra is now coming in freely. ways the "Ceylon Observer. (19 Fifteen boat-loads were offered on a recent date, and there was keen Competition, chiefly among the millers. The highest price paid was Rs. 86.75 per candy for super- ior parcels. The slack season will soon be on and it is not impossible that prices will shoot up to the record prices of last year. It almost looks as if prices at this time next your will be firm and, if anything, higher than this year's ruling rates. This surmise is based on the fact of the recent devastations at Manila through a typoon.
